Default Debris under house

Do you guys report debris under the house. In this instance I found some old insulation in the crawl space I wrote it up would you guys have written it up?

Default Re: Debris under house

A can or bottle, no. An old furnace, water heater, or lots of insulation, old ducts, etc. yes. If it's significant enough to include, I say it could be a haven for rodents.
